Closed Loop Stepper motor controller/driver module 12 to 48V, 3A, 256 µSteps, with USB, EtherCAT Interface

Features

Bipolar stepper motor driver
  • Up to 256 microsteps per full step
  • High-efficient operation, low power dissipation
  • Dynamic current control
  • Integrated protection: overtemperature and undervoltage
  • stallGuard2 feature for stall detection ( for open loop operation)
Interfaces
  • USB 2.0 full-speed (12Mbit/s) communication interface (mini-USB connector)
  • EtherCAT LINK IN and LINK OUT (RJ45)
  • Dedicated STOP_L / STOP_R inputs
  • Up to 8 multi-purpose inputs (+24V compatible, incl. 2 dedicated analog inputs)
  • Up to 8 multi-purpose outputs (open-drain, incl. 2 outputs for currents up to 1A)
Mechanical data
  • Size: 110mm x 110mm, height 26.3mm
Encoder
  • Encoder input for incremental a/b/n (TTL, open-collector and differential inputs) and absolute SSI encoders (selectable in software) with speeds supported <500kHz.
Software
  • TMCL remote (direct mode) and standalone operation with memory for up to 1024 TMCL commands
  • Closed-loop support
  • Fully supported by TMCL-IDE (PC based integrated development environment)
Electrical data
  • Supply voltage: +12V to +48V DC
  • Motor current: up to 3A RMS (programmable)

Part details & applications

The TMCM-1310 is a fully closed single axis stepper control unit for all applications that require high reliability and dynamics. The device is powered by ADI Trinamic StallGuard2, CoolStep and SpreadCycle chopper technology. The TMCM-1310 is capable of driving up to 4.3A of current from each output (with proper heatsinking). It is designed for an operating voltage of 9 to 51V. The device provides an USB, EtherCAT and encoder interface. An integrated protocol processor supplies a high level CANopen® over EtherCAT communication.

All you need to get started is a power supply and ADI Trinamic's free and easy to use TMCL-IDE. This graphical user interface allows quick setup and supports the use of commands in direct mode, monitors real-time behavior visualized in graphs, and logs and stores data.
